The Larkstone public API paginates with opaque cursors, not page numbers. Pass the cursor from each response's next field; never construct one yourself. Page size caps at 100. Cursors expire after ten minutes, so don't cache them across sessions. To exercise the staging endpoints, unlock the sandbox credentials store using the recovery passphrase below.

unlock words, tawif-tahop: oliys-ulawyn-tamdor-lamys-casox-jormir-fraius-kasath-ulador-ulamir-holir-sorys-holeth

### Runbook: Account Recovery — Connection Pool Exhaustion

Plugin authors: if your plugin holds Brightfen database connections past the 30-second lease, the pooler may quarantine your service account, and subsequent connections will fail with POOL_DENIED. First, release all held connections and restart your worker. Then request account recovery through the Brightfen developer portal, which verifies your plugin manifest and resets the quarantine flag. The final confirmation screen asks for the recovery passphrase printed below.

recovery phrase for bawef-haduf: wenax-druox-julmir

## Runbook: Bramblefork Assignment Service — Review Notes

Bramblefork assigns users to experiment variants using a salted hash of the user key. Assignments are stateless; no user data is persisted beyond the audit log, which rotates daily. Variant weights and salts are loaded from config at startup, and any change triggers a full restart. For the scope of this security review, the production configuration in effect is listed below.

deployment values, bahof-badug:
[rusix]
team = zorok
access_code = ac_641cbe
owner = ulair.tamius
host = rusix.torvasoft.local
port = 5672
peer = ulaix.sivrelworks.internal
salt = 1df570ed
pin = 6327

/*
 * Client setup for the Galehorn weather-alert fan-out service.
 * Security note: this client only publishes to the internal Stormquill
 * broker; it never touches public endpoints. Messages are signed before
 * fan-out, and subscriber lists are pulled read-only from the Rookfield
 * registry. The credential here is scoped to publish-only on the
 * alerts.severe topic and rotates monthly via the vault sync job.
 * The broker authenticates this client with the key below.
 */

service key, fawip-bajef: kto11_Qt5wZK9vdNC